As artificial intelligence rapidly evolves, so do the threats it poses—and the tools it gives us to fight back. In this talk, PhD researcher Shashvat explores how AI can both protect and compromise digital systems. You’ll learn how AIs can be “jailbroken” to leak sensitive information, how they’re being used to discover new security vulnerabilities, and why deploying AI systems that surpass human intelligence brings massive safety challenges. Speaker:
Shashvat is a PhD researcher at UCL and a member of the Singapore AI Safety Hub. He works on the following questions:
What are the applications of quantum computing?
What are security risks of quantum computers and how can we mitigate the expected harms?
How will quantum computing affect AI capabilities and AI risks?
He has previously worked as a market analyst with The Quantum Insider, and won top academic prizes at Oxford for both Computer Science and Philosophy.
